Bangladesh vs Sri Lanka: Net financial account
Net financial account over time
- Bangladesh
- Sri Lanka
How they compare
Sri Lanka currently reports 891.97 million BoP, current US$ against 716.23 million BoP, current US$ in Bangladesh, a difference of 175.74 million BoP, current US$.
That makes Sri Lanka's figure about 1.2 times Bangladesh's.
The two have swapped places 14 times across 49 shared years of data; in 1976 it was Sri Lanka ahead.
Bangladesh ranks 51st and Sri Lanka ranks 49th of 199 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Bangladesh averaged higher in 3 and Sri Lanka in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bangladesh | Sri Lanka |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| -245.98 million BoP, current US$ | -25.80 million BoP, current US$ | 220.18 million BoP, current US$ | Sri Lanka |
| 1980s | -589.46 million BoP, current US$ | -434.45 million BoP, current US$ | 155.01 million BoP, current US$ | Sri Lanka |
| 1990s | -57.11 million BoP, current US$ | -368.94 million BoP, current US$ | 311.83 million BoP, current US$ | Bangladesh |
| 2000s | -13.67 million BoP, current US$ | -750.16 million BoP, current US$ | 736.50 million BoP, current US$ | Bangladesh |
| 2010s | -1.80 billion BoP, current US$ | -2.79 billion BoP, current US$ | 986.86 million BoP, current US$ | Bangladesh |
| 2020s | -10.27 billion BoP, current US$ | -759.80 million BoP, current US$ | 9.51 billion BoP, current US$ | Sri Lanka |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The net financial account shows net acquisition and disposal of financial assets and liabilities. It measures how net lending to or borrowing from nonresidents is financed, and is conceptually equal to the sum of the balances on the current and capital accounts. This indicator is expressed in current prices, meaning no adjustment has been made to account for price changes over time. This indicator is expressed in United States dollars.
